Forecasting is an important aid in effective and efficient planning. opinions on forecasting are probably as diverse as views on any set of scientific methods used by decision makers. the layperson may question the validity and efficacy of a discipline aimed at predicting an uncertain future. Quantitative forecasting methods are used to forecast future data with help of past data. this methods are convenient to use when past data is available in numerical form and when it can be assumed that the pattern in the data will continue in the future. All demand forecasting methods vary in the degree to which they emphasize recent demand changes when making a forecast. forecasting methods that react very strongly (or quickly) to demand changes are said to be responsive.
